About Ramen:
Authentic Chinese flavor with scallops, shrimp sauce, and scallion oil in a Beijing-style salty broth, combined with firm and resilient non-fried noodles. The aroma of scallion oil and sesame oil has been enhanced.
How to cook:
1 Prepare 50g boiled salad chicken
As a preparation, cut boiled "salad chicken" into small pieces.
*A loosened type of salad chicken is convenient.
2 Cut your favorite ingredients into bite-size pieces
Prepare Chinese cabbage, white onion, etc. as desired.
3 Prepare boiled water
Fill a pot with 500 ml of boiling water and bring it to a boil over a flame.
4 Cook noodles and ingredients for "4 minutes
Add the noodles and ingredients to the pot and cook for 4 minutes while unraveling.
5 Add powder soup and liquid soup
When the noodles are loosened, turn off the heat and add the powdered soup and liquid soup, stirring well.
6. Serve in bowls to complete the dish.
Transfer the noodles to a bowl first, then add the soup and ingredients on top of the noodles, and it is ready to serve.
